Output 3d5f9cb86d9ec5cdcec2d4e2e99239f1ae1983854837f44e95a5e5dd4f73b79c:0

value
1590489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52de54312475e563790372557dd9e81deb5dbdca OP_EQUAL
address
39FBfxLVyrr7SPhNmsaMd1RR4pcUP1y5uA
transaction
3d5f9cb86d9ec5cdcec2d4e2e99239f1ae1983854837f44e95a5e5dd4f73b79c
confirmations
12596
spent
true